BTS Data Release: US Airlines net gain was $4 billion in second quarter 2025, an increase in net gain over second quarter 2024 U.S. scheduled passenger airlines reported a second-quarter 2025 after-tax net income of $4.0 billion and a pre-tax operating profit of $5.0 billion.

BTS Data Release: North American Transborder Freight decreased 1.1% in July 2025 from July 2024 Total transborder freight: $132.6 billion - U.S. and Canada: $58.3B - U.S. and Mexico: $74.4B - Trucks: $87.3B - Railways: $14.4B - Pipelines: $9.0B - Vessels: $8.8B - Air: $6.1B

#OTD in 1968...U.S. Department of Transportation accepted 2 TurboTrains from United Aircraft Corp. Part of the 1965 High-Speed Ground Transportation Act, the program determined the extent of public acceptance of improved intercity rail passenger service. #OTD in U.S. Department of Transportation #transportationhistory: In 1959, the Human Factors Lab was established as part of the Civil Aeromedical Research Center in Oklahoma City. Now known as Civil Aerospace Medical Institute (CAMI), this FAA facility oversees aeromedical research and education. The FAA ✈️
